      Job Summary

      This position will act as the first line of support for all troubleshooting and issue resolution for HR systems, including SuccessFactors and SAP HR. Position will also lead the coordination and execution of all upgrade support activities. In future the incumbent would also be encouraged to acquire knowledge of new technology solutions, and be involved in the development & implementation of new technology solutions.

      Principal Duties & Responsibilities

      • Respond to routine transaction requests for SuccessFactors and SAP HR.
      • Be the first line of support for all troubleshooting and issue resolution
      • Expertise in SAP SuccessFactors Modules like Employee Central, Learning Management System, Recruiting, Onboarding, Performance and Goal Management, Career Development, Succession Planning.
      • Work with all relevant teams in CBS, COHRE and GIT to research, analyze, troubleshoot and resolve SuccessFactors and SAP HR system issues.
      • Conduct root cause analysis of problems and apply business knowledge and practical experience to recommend system and product enhancements.
      • Escalate issues to GIT/GSSO teams as needed.
      • Develop test scripts based on business requirements, perform thorough testing of fixes and document results.
      • Lead the coordination and execution of testing cycles, troubleshooting and issue resolution for all planned upgrades and rollouts of enhancements for all HR systems, collaborating with GIT and HR teams to ensure successful implementation.
      • Lead the execution of ongoing testing and documentation requirements necessary to support and maintain LMS validation.
      • Make system configuration changes as necessary for key system enhancements.

      Colgate-Palmolive is a leading global consumer products company, tightly focused on Oral Care, Personal Care, Home Care and Pet Nutrition. Colgate sells its products in over 200 countries and territories around the world under such internationally recognized brand names as Colgate, Palmolive, elmex, Tom’s of Maine, Sorriso, Speed Stick, Lady Speed Stick, Softsoap, Irish Spring, Protex, Sanex, Elta MD, PCA Skin, Ajax, Axion, Fabuloso, Soupline and Suavitel, as well as Hill’s Science Diet and Hill’s Prescription Diet.

      Colgate-Palmolive Company is an American multinational consumer products company headquartered on Park Avenue in Midtown Manhattan, New York City. It specializes in the production, distribution and provision of household, health care, personal care and veterinary products.
